Proposed Measurable Outcome(s)

Participants will learn about the basics of acrylic painting, including paints, color, composition, and other elements. They will be guided through the process of creating a 11” x 14” canvas painting.

Measurable Outcome(s)

Participants:
1) learned how to paint an object and background, including techniques such as outlining, blending colors, layering and drying paint, and adding details,
2) Gained confidence in their ability to paint, as well as inspiration to continue developing their painting skills,
3) Enjoyed meeting and learning with others who have similar interests.
Participant Response:
Participants expressed confidence in their new skills and believed they could paint another picture at home.
